Gnash
Gnash, born Garrett Charles Nash, is a multitalented American singer, songwriter, and record producer. He first gained recognition in 2015 with his breakout single "i hate u, i love u," featuring Olivia O'Brien, which reached the top 10 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art. Known for his soulful vocals and heartfelt lyrics, Gnash often incorporates elements of pop, hip-hop, and electronic music into his songs. His music resonates with fans due to its relatable themes of love, heartbreak, and personal growth. In addition to his own work, Gnash has collaborated with various artists, including MAX, Ava Max, and 24kGoldn. His debut extended play (EP), "us," was released in 2017, followed by the album "we."
